There is still space for you in these classes this weekend with Andrew and Kelly!

Saturday AND Sunday 9:00-11:00am
(Dynamic led by Andrew)
These all levels dynamic practices will contain all the necessary ingredients to leave you feeling grounded and deeply at ease. Expect a strong, yet accessible asana practice with pranayama techniques and an element of meditation.

Saturday 6:00-8:00pm
(RESTORE led by Kelly)
This class is intended to help nourish and support the nervous system while giving the body space to unwind. With a yin/restorative focus, we'll explore postures that serve to lengthen the muscles and tissues, ground the body, and support integration through longer holds.

Sunday 2:00-4:00pm
(WORKSHOP, co-led)
In this workshop, we'll explore a granular and methodical approach to the previous sequences. Expect a slower-paced practice with a focus on the principles of alignment. We'll also hold space for a shared conversation around the concept of Pratyahara, and the techniques we'll be exploring throughout the weekend. Questions welcomed!

Monday, February 5th @ 6:00-7:15 pm

"75Min Heated Yin"

Yin yoga is a slow and calm practice that targets the deepest tissues of the body, our connective tissues โ€“ ligaments, joints, bones, the deep fascia networks of the body and the meridians. Connective tissue typically responds well to a slow, steady load, which is why we hold the poses for longer (2-5 mins each). Bringing the temperature in the room up a few degrees will help deepen your stretches.
*This will not be sweaty hot - just nice and warm.*
